What is River Financial?

River Financial is a financial services company that specializes in Bitcoin-related products and services. They provide a platform for buying, selling, and managing Bitcoin, with a focus on security and customer support. River Financial also offers Bitcoin mining services and tools for individuals and businesses looking to navigate the Bitcoin ecosystem. Their mission is to make Bitcoin accessible and secure for everyone, from beginners to experienced investors.

Job Summary
To support high school students in completing Red River Promise and NCTC enrollment requirements through outreach and individualized assistance.
Responsibilities include assisting students with admissions, FAFSA, scholarships, document submission, and community service requirements; conducting outreach and support visits at local high schools; maintaining communication with students and school partners; and providing administrative, event, and operational support for Red River Promise programs and activities.
This is part-time, with a maximum of 19 hours per week. Applicants must have applied for financial aid and have financial need, including enrollment at NCTC.
